Squad Ratings: England Triumph Sealed by Harry Kane's Double in World Cup Qualifying Match

In a commanding performance, England clinched another triumph versus Albania, with multiple players delivering standout performances during the match.

First-choice XI

The goalkeeper Had little to do to make during the opening 45 until forced to intervene from an opponent's curled attempt. His sliding challenge on Qazim Laci showed sharp anticipation. 6/10

The debutant Examined by Albania’s primary attacker in their forward. Played through the middle early on later drifted out wide once a teammate entered the fray. 7

The defender Pushed into midfield with the ball at his feet, a familiar role in the past. At times seemed hesitant on the ball and the tactic discontinued after the break. 6

The tall defender Always dangerous from dead balls, typically, perhaps is a replacement to Stones in defense as opposed to his partner. One wayward ball in the second half nearly resulted in the first goal from Albania. Six

The young full-back One more composed display from the 20-year-old following his initial appearance versus another side. Saka did not capitalize on the most of an exquisite touch over their defense. His position looks secure so soon. Seven

The newcomer A debut start for his country. A bit sloppy on the ball though his dangerous deliveries were a threat. A useful tempo-setter for the manager to have versus defensive opponents. Cautioned after a reckless tackle. 6

Declan Rice Crosses from dead balls and set-plays caused problems. Was given freedom to move in left midfield yet found himself in an offside position when the ball arrived with a chance to score. Awarded a well-earned break around the 60-minute point. 6/10

Jude Bellingham Functioned in a forward position out wide and also put in defensive duties. Demonstrated moments of class and dragged an attempt wide. Withdrawn late on by Rogers, his rival, following a yellow card. Seven

Jarrod Bowen Was presented with the team's top opening before halftime, his shot well saved from the opposing goalkeeper. With Quansah hanging back, he had to offer an outlet on the right although his balls from wide areas varied in quality. Taken off for the final quarter-hour. 6

Harry Kane The decisive figure scoring two more finishes in an England shirt. The opener a trademark close-range tap-in while the second a superb header after peeling away from his marker. At 32, he continues to improve and England have every chance next summer with him up top. 8

The attacker Struggled to get into the game on the left flank. Was presented with a presentable chance following a pass from a teammate but Strakosha made the save. Rashford made much more of influence in his place. 5
